“Be self-controlled and alert. Your enemy the devil prowls around like a roaring lion looking for someone to devour.” 1 Peter 5:8
Interesting, isn’t it, how some childhood experiences are
permanently seared into our memory banks? One of my unforgettable
memories is of watching my boyhood friend Bobby getting hit by a car.
After church one Sunday morning, he and I were standing on the front
steps talking. Why he decided to bolt into the street between two parked
cars I’ll never know. But that is exactly what he did. As Bobby ran
between the cars, his mother, who could see a car coming, screamed:
“Stop! Bobby, Stop!” Whether he didn’t hear her or didn’t care I’m not
sure. He just kept running. What haunts me to this day is the memory of
the sound of screeching brakes and the thud of his body against the car’s fender. I need to tell you that I am tired of hearing the thud
of fellow followers of Jesus getting hit by Satan. Like friends who
thought that the most important thing in life was career advancement,
only to hear the thud of the long-term damage to their kids and
spouses. Or of those who sold out to the allure of an affair—or to the
addictive seduction of porn—and are now left with the regrets of the
collateral damage of their choices.
It’s easy to think you can get ahead by putting other people down or
that intimidation and manipulation are handy tools for staying in
control. But the thud of ruined relationships and reputations
is a big price to pay for doing whatever is necessary to keep yourself
on top. Lying to weasel out of a problem erodes the trust factor and
compromises the strength of your character. The list of thud-able choices is long and the consequences are often irreversible.
Granted, we are sometimes blindsided by our ignorance or
instinctively wrong about our responses to life. But thankfully, God is
never blindsided. And, He’s never wrong. From His vantage point He has a
clear view of Satan’s destructive attempts to thud our lives.
So, like Bobby’s mom, He warns us with clear and unmistakable shouts
from His Word. God’s Word is full of warnings about things like greed,
selfishness, lying, lust, gossip, hatred, bitterness, envy,
argumentative attitudes, stealing, murmuring, oppression, and ignoring
the needs of the poor and underprivileged. So, it’s not that there is a
lack of clarity in His voice. The problem is ours. Too often, like
Bobby, we either are not listening, or we just don’t care.
The warning shouts of Bobby’s mother came from a heart of love and
concern for Bobby’s welfare and safety. God warns us as well because He
loves us deeply and wants to rescue us from the impending disaster of
that thud in our own lives. It’s easy to think of God’s
warnings and prohibitions as His attempt to take all the fun out of our
lives, but that’s so wrong. In fact, nothing would give Satan more joy
than getting you to think like that, because the more you think like
that, the easier it is for him to “devour” you. And that’s a thud that I never want to hear!
